ROAR: START treaty is “last Cold War-like agreement” - RT

Both sides agreed to achieve parity in terms of warheads and carriers in 2017. U.S. President Barack Obama has also promised not to break the agreements on missile defense in Europe, Trud newspaper said.

Most analysts are confident that the pact signed will be useful for all parties, the document notes. "The treaty has proved that resetting said relations between Russia and the United States is working," deputy director of the Institute for USA and Canadian Studies, Pavel Zolotarev said.

Even the process of drawing up the treaty itself is important, because the leaders of both countries have been able to understand each other better, the analyst told the newspaper.

Russia receives tangible benefits, observers say. One of them is the fact that this country as powerful as the U.S. will slash its nuclear arsenal, "said Sergei Karaganov, chairman of the board of the Council on Foreign and Defense Policy. Russia will be reduced mainly surplus weapons which can be discarded because of deterioration, "he added.

Even critics of the treaty believe that Russia has reached agreement on favorable terms, the newspaper said. "We have received all Americans that we could," said Leonid Ivashov, president of the Academy of Geopolitical Problems. And Moscow could withdraw from the agreement if the U.S. missile shield in Europe threatens the security of Russia, he told the newspaper.

But the document does not contain any direct restrictions on missile defense, noted the analyst."The treaty does not contribute much to Russia, where the negotiators failed to link the signing of the START program with the U.S. missile defense," said Ivashov.

In developing the pact, a law was passed in the United States which prohibits the authorities to stop missile defense program, said the analyst. "We were not able to use the new treaty to stop the development of a new class of missiles by the United States, he added....
